On the oral prayer made by Mr. Panda, learned counsel for the Petitioner, he is permitted to implead the Authorised Officer-cum-Divisional Forest Officer, Keonjhar Forest Division, Keonjhar as Opposite Party No.3 to the writ petition. 3.

The Petitioner in this writ petition prays for a direction to the Authorized Officer-cum-Divisional Forest Officer, Keonjhar Forest Division, Keonjhar-Opposite Party No.3 for early disposal of confiscation proceeding in O.R. Case No.60P of 2020-2021 pending before him in respect of the vehicle bearing Registration No.OD-09-J-1239 (Tractor) and OR-09-J-1240 (Trolley).

4.

Taking into consideration the submission made by Mr. Panda, learned counsel for the Petitioner, this Court vide order dated 11th July, 2022 directed learned State Counsel to take instruction in the matter. Mr. Mishra, learned Additional Standing Counsel produces a copy of the order sheet of the aforesaid confiscation proceeding, which reveals that the same is

// 2 // pending. He, however, submits that the matter was placed before the Authorized Officer-cum-Divisional Forest Officer, Keonjhar Forest Division, Keonjhar only on 28th June, 2022 and thereafter, the Authorized Officer is taking diligent step for early disposal of the same.

5.

Taking into consideration the submission made by learned counsel for the parties, this Court without expressing any opinion on the merits of the case of the Petitioner in the confiscation proceeding, disposes of this writ petition with a direction that the Authorized Officer-cum-Divisional Forest Officer, Keonjhar Forest Division, Keonjhar-Opposite Party No.3 shall do well to proceed with the matter and make an endeavour for early disposal of confiscation proceeding in O.R. Case No.60P of 2020-2021 as expeditiously as possible, preferably within a period of eight months from the date of production of certified copy of this order, giving opportunity of hearing to the parties concerned, if there is no legal impediment. 6.

The Petitioner is also directed to cooperate with the Authorized Officer-cum-Divisional Forest Officer, Keonjhar Forest Division, Keonjhar-Opposite Party No.3 for early disposal of the confiscation proceeding.
